Eastern Railroad Discussion > CSX - south Alabama area receives "select site" honorDate: 07/24/17 05:21 CSX - south Alabama area receives "select site" honor Author: Lackawanna484 CSX has a press release out, designating a large area near Bay Minnette AL as a select site on CSX. The location is on CSX's Mobile to Pensecola line, with properties that that have already met due diligence, land use, zoning etc standards.
Sounds like heads up marketing by CSX. Substantial labor force, good location, and active government support. I was interested to see that the boilerplate now includes wording that CSX connects with 240 short line railroads.
